An Advanced Certificate in Farm Ownership Transition is increasingly significant in the UK's dynamic agricultural landscape. The UK faces a critical shortage of new entrants to farming, with an ageing farming population and a lack of succession planning contributing to farm closures. According to the 2021 census, over 50% of UK farmers are aged over 55, highlighting the urgent need for effective farm ownership transition strategies. This certificate addresses this pressing issue by equipping learners with the skills and knowledge to navigate the complexities of farm business transfer, including legal, financial, and tax implications.
This program is vital for both existing farm owners seeking to plan their succession and aspiring young farmers looking to enter the industry. Effective transition planning not only secures the future of family farms but also contributes to the overall stability and productivity of the UK agricultural sector.
